Suffix edit
-'kö
- Forms diminutives of nouns and pronouns.
- Forms a handful of adverbs relating to small size or amount.
- Forms the comparative form of adverbs.
Usage notes edit
The diminutive suffix follows after any other derivational and inflectional suffixes on the word it attaches to.
